[Bug 1232454] Re: "Computer will suspend very soon because of inactivity." dialog when resuming from suspend

2014-01-26 Thread Ray Velez
One way to alleviate the problem of the power 'notify' dialog box is to access under 'system settings' the 'Brightness & Lock' function. There disable the 'Lock screen after' function and the next time your system is awakened from suspend mode the 'notify' dialog is no longer. -- You received thi

[Bug 857651] Re: Unable to hide users from login screen / user switcher

2014-01-26 Thread Gunnar Hjalmarsson
Creating a user with UID < 1000 works for me as a workaround, since I'm using lightdm-gtk-greeter, which has an "Other" option that allows you to type the username of the account you want to log in to. unity-greeter does not have this option, so a modification to unity-greeter seems to be needed to
